The Glenfield Model A is a full-size bolt-action hunting rifle chambered in .270 Winchester. It pairs a 20-inch threaded, cold-hammer-forged barrel with a Moss Green Splatter synthetic stock and a matte black alloy-steel receiver. The rifle is equipped with a factory-installed one-piece Picatinny scope base, an adjustable trigger and a tang safety for straightforward operation in the field.
Key Specifications
- The rifle is chambered in .270 Winchester for common hunting and field use.
- The action is a bolt action with a one-piece, three-lug bolt and a 70° throw.
- The barrel measures 20 inches and is threaded with a 5/8-24 pattern with a factory thread protector.
- The stock is a Moss Green Splatter synthetic fixed design with a rubber buttpad.
- The finish on metal components is matte black on alloy steel.
- The adjustable trigger is user-adjustable between 3 and 5 pounds for a tailored pull weight.
- The rate of twist is 1:10″ RH with 5 grooves.
- The rifle has an overall length of 40.5 inches and a length of pull of 13.75 inches.
- The listed weight is approximately 6.6 lbs for carry and handling considerations.
- Factory features include a one-piece Picatinny scope base, sling swivel studs and one included magazine.
